Multi Device Security

Authentication

Multi Device Security, within financial markets, necessitates robust authentication protocols extending beyond single-factor verification to mitigate unauthorized access across varied platforms. The proliferation of devices introduces expanded attack surfaces, demanding adaptive authentication methods like biometric verification and multi-factor authentication (MFA) to confirm user identity. Effective implementation requires a layered approach, integrating device recognition and behavioral biometrics to detect anomalous activity and prevent fraudulent transactions, particularly crucial for crypto asset custody and derivatives trading. Consequently, a strong authentication framework is paramount for maintaining market integrity and investor confidence.
